Originally I used 4-mil double stick tape to secure the battery, but my latest shipment of batteries aren't as flat on the bottom so that wasn't working out. I used some hot glue and it didn't hold on a few amps in shipment. I've gone back to double sided tape only much thicker this time.

Wow this pico is REALLY GOOD. I'm not kidding because it brought out the characteristics of my headphones that I had a really hard time hearing out with my AT amp.

Yes the Pico obliterates the AT amp

I'm bad at describing sound but if I had to, I'd say the AT DAC/amp does the job of providing the digital to analog conversion and that is all.

AT Amp: It is pretty muddy overall and when I listen to more complicated tracks, different guitars sound identical and the lower range like the kick drums and bass are more similar sounding. In hindsight, I realized I couldn't hear a lot of things with it. I don't think this amp is worthy enough to drive my headphones because it simply did the job of providing a DAC but has a horrible amp.

Pico: I heard things I never knew were in the music. I felt that my rig really deserves something better than the AT amp and the Pico really lives up to its reputation. I'm not exaggerating when I say that my headphones have transformed after I started using the Pico because prior to this they didn't sound so great compared to now.
